What is a part time accounting?

A part time accounting job involves performing accounting tasks, such as bookkeeping, preparing financial reports, managing invoices, and reconciling accounts, but on a reduced schedule compared to a full-time role. These positions are ideal for individuals seeking flexibility, such as students, parents, or those supplementing other work. Part time accountants may work for businesses, accounting firms, or as independent contractors, and their responsibilities can vary depending on the employer's need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time accounting professional?

To thrive as a Part Time Accounting professional, you need a solid understanding of basic accounting principles, proficiency in bookkeeping, and often an associate’s degree or relevant coursework in accounting. Familiarity with accounting software like QuickBooks, Excel, and possibly experience with ERP systems is highly valuable. Attention to detail, time management, and strong organizational skills help individuals excel in balancing multiple clients or tasks within limited hours. These skills and qualifications ensure accurate financial records, effective workflow, and compliance with reporting standards, which are crucial for supporting business operations.

How does a part-time accounting role typically integrate with full-time accounting staff and broader finance teams?

Part-time accountants usually work closely with full-time staff by focusing on specific tasks such as reconciliations, data entry, or assisting with month-end closings. They often coordinate with full-time accountants to ensure consistency and accuracy in financial records, and may attend regular team meetings to stay aligned on priorities. Communication is key, as part-time team members need to stay updated on ongoing projects and deadlines. While their schedules are more flexible, part-time accountants are expected to maintain high standards of organization and responsiveness to support the overall finance team’s objectives.

What is the difference between Part Time Accounting vs Bookkeeping?

AspectPart Time AccountingBookkeeping
CredentialsOften requires accounting certifications or coursesTypically requires basic bookkeeping knowledge, sometimes with certifications
Work EnvironmentCan include small businesses, accounting firms, or remote workUsually in small business settings or accounting departments
Employer UsageUsed for financial analysis, reporting, and complianceFocused on recording financial transactions and maintaining ledgers

Part Time Accounting involves broader financial responsibilities, including analysis and reporting, often requiring certifications. Bookkeeping is more focused on recording daily financial transactions. Both roles are essential in finance but differ in scope and complexity.
